Training Facility

RFG is a firm believer in training and education, and our training facilities and training support programs are testimony to this. All of our franchisees must satisfactorily complete training programs conducted in-field and at our Training Academy, which is licensed under the Food Act 2006 and meets the highest standards of Food Safety and compliance. All RFG Trainers hold a nationally accredited qualification in Training and Assessment and are committed to ensuring positive training outcomes. It is important that all franchisees commencing a career in franchising with RFG be provided with a holistic approach to understanding franchising, and a best practice training solution from leading Learning and Development professionals. Our blended training program (ranging from 5 – 8 weeks) combines skills and knowledge and in-store training to assess capability. From ordering their first round of stock to their first week of trade, we’re with them every step of the way.

Franchisee Approval Process

All Franchisors in Australia must, by law, adhere to the Franchising Code of Conduct as part of the franchise recruitment process (when someone is purchasing a franchise). The ‘Code’ is designed to regulate the ongoing relationship between the franchisee and franchisor, and is regulated by the ACCC (Australian Competition and Consumer Commission). On average, the timeline to acquire an RFG franchise will take approximately three months to complete. During this period, applications are reviewed by our internal Brand Management, Legal, Finance, Sales and Leasing, and Learning and Development departments.
